Time to give McCarron his Jr tryout?

That can only happen in an emergency situation (less than 12 healthy forwards). One might exist if Briere or Prust can't go next game but even then, his recall would take the Habs into LTIR (which they're likely trying to avoid). Also, McCarron isn't playing all that well at the moment; he has been demoted to the 3rd line.
